Next.js is an open-source web development framework built on top of React. It simplifies the process of building modern web applications by providing a robust structure and features out of the box. Developed by Vercel, Next.js is widely used by developers and companies for its speed, performance, and flexibility.
Why Should You Use Next.js?
1. Server-Side Rendering (SSR)
Next.js enables server-side rendering, which means pages are generated on the server and delivered fully rendered to the client. This improves load times and is especially beneficial for SEO.
2. Static Site Generation (SSG)
For content that doesn’t change often, Next.js offers static site generation, which pre-renders pages at build time. This leads to blazing-fast performance and reduced server costs.
3. Built-in Routing and API Routes
Next.js comes with a file-based routing system, making it easy to manage navigation. It also allows you to create backend APIs using the same codebase with its API routes feature.
4. SEO Optimization
Thanks to SSR and SSG, Next.js helps improve search engine rankings by ensuring content is readily indexable by search bots.
5. Developer Experience and Ecosystem
Next.js offers excellent developer experience with fast refresh, TypeScript support, and seamless integration with popular tools and CMSs. It also has a large community and is backed by Vercel.

Next.js is a top choice for building eCommerce websites due to its performance, flexibility, and SEO-friendliness. Here’s why:
1. Fast Loading Speeds
Next.js supports static site generation (SSG) and server-side rendering (SSR), which drastically reduce load times—a critical factor for eCommerce user experience and conversions.
2. SEO Optimization
With built-in support for dynamic meta tags, SSR, and clean URL structures, Next.js ensures your product pages are easily discoverable by search engines.
3. Scalability
As your online store grows, Next.js can scale seamlessly. It supports complex integrations, real-time updates, and large product catalogs without performance issues.
4. Mobile-First Experience
Its responsive design capabilities ensure smooth functionality across all devices—essential for modern shoppers.
5. Custom Integrations
Whether it’s payment gateways, inventory systems, or third-party APIs, Next.js offers the flexibility to integrate with various tools efficiently.
In short, if you’re aiming to build a fast, SEO-friendly, and scalable online store, Next.js is an excellent framework to consider

The development timeline for a Next.js application varies based on several factors, including the project’s complexity, required features, design needs, and third-party integrations. Here’s a general breakdown:
1. Basic Applications (3–6 Weeks)
Simple websites or MVPs (Minimum Viable Products) with limited features can typically be developed within 3 to 6 weeks. This includes design, front-end development, and basic backend/API integration.
2. Moderate Projects (6–10 Weeks)
Web apps with custom user flows, dynamic content, and integrations like payment gateways, CRM, or CMS often take 1.5 to 2.5 months to complete.
3. Complex Platforms (3–6 Months)
Large-scale platforms with advanced features like dashboards, real-time data, multi-user access, and complex logic can take several months. This timeline also includes thorough testing, performance optimization, and post-launch support.
4. Factors That Influence Time
Number of pages and components
Design revisions and approval cycles
Third-party tools and services
Client feedback and change requests
Conclusion: Next.js is a flexible framework that supports rapid development, but the total timeline depends on your specific business goals and technical requirements
